1. Academic Reputation and Global Rankings

The University of Valparaíso, founded in 1842, has a rich history and is well-regarded within Chile. However, when it comes to global rankings, the story gets a bit more nuanced. While it doesn’t crack the top 100 in major international rankings like the QS World University Rankings or Times Higher Education, it does hold a respectable position among Latin American institutions. For instance, it often ranks in the top 50 universities in Chile, which is no small feat given the region’s competitive educational landscape. 🏆

2. Academic Programs and Research Opportunities

One of the key factors in assessing a university’s quality is the breadth and depth of its academic programs. The University of Valparaíso offers a wide array of undergraduate and graduate programs across various disciplines, including law, engineering, and social sciences. The university also prides itself on its research output, particularly in areas such as marine science and environmental studies, given its coastal location. For students interested in hands-on research experiences, this could be a significant draw. 🌊🔬

3. International Student Experience and Cultural Integration

Choosing a university is not just about academics; it’s also about the overall student experience. The University of Valparaíso has made strides in attracting international students and fostering a multicultural environment. However, it’s worth noting that the majority of classes are conducted in Spanish, which might pose a language barrier for non-Spanish speakers. On the flip side, this presents an excellent opportunity for students to immerse themselves in the local culture and language, enhancing their global competency. 🌍🗣️
